What is a digital object?
object whose component parts include one or more bitstrings.
What is a bitstring?
sequence of 0s and 1s
that follows syntactical rules,
such as those of a file format
What are the two important characteristics of objects?
Objects are structured and enduring.
What does “structured” mean?
Multiple parts are put together in an organized fashion.
What does “enduring” mean?
The object has full presence during the complete span of its existence.
What is the difference between a non-digital object and a digital object?
non-digital object: does not contain any bitstrings,
a digital object: contains one or more bitstrings
What is the three-layer conceptualization of digital innovation?
Digital Object → Digital Technology → Digital Innovation
Digital Object
= purely technical
Digital Technology
= socially agreed-upon meaning
Digital Innovation
= digital technology used to create value in novel ways.
What is digital technology?
digital object
that has been assigned a socially agreed-upon meaning.
Why can the same digital object have different identities?
digital objects can be used in different ways
and different groups can assign different meanings to them.
What is digital innovation?
creation, adoption, and exploitation of an
inherently unbounded,
value-adding novelty through the incorporation of digital technology.
What does it mean that digital innovation is a sociotechnical phenomenon?
Digital innovation is not only a technical advancement; its meaning and use can evolve socially over time.
What is digitization?
process of converting analog signals into a digital form and ultimately into binary digits (bits).
What is the transformation caused by digitization?
Non-digital object → Digital object
What is digitalization?
a sociotechnical process
of applying digitizing techniques to broader social and institutional contexts.
What is the transformation caused by digitalization?
Digital object → Digital technology
What is the key difference between digitization and digitalization?
Digitization: converts analog information into digital form.
Digitalization: applies digital techniques in broader social and institutional contexts.
What is data homogenization?
Any digital content form can be accessed by any kind of digital device, thereby separating content and medium
What is reprogrammability?
The ability of a digital device to perform an almost unlimited number of functions.
What is self-reference?
Digital innovation creates value
and changes the sociotechnical environment,
which enables even more digital innovation.
What is the virtuous cycle of self-reference?
Digital innovation → novel value creation → changes in the sociotechnical environment → more opportunities for digital innovation
What are possible effects of self-reference?
Lowered entry barriers
decreased learning costs
accelerated diffusion rates
positive network externalities.
What are the main characteristics of digital innovation?
Sociotechnical phenomenon
New level of fluidity
Distributed innovation agency
User co-creation
Layered modular architecture
Generativity
What is distributed innovation agency?
Innovation involves dynamic sets of actors who are not necessarily controlled by a single organization
What is important about the actors in distributed innovation agency?
They may belong to different organizations and
may only work together temporarily, making innovation more distributed and heterogeneous.
What is user co-creation?
Users actively participate in creating or shaping digital products,
services,
applications,
or content
rather than being only consumers.
What is layered modular architecture?
An assemblage of product-agnostic components on different layers
that allows separation and/or new mixing of contents and/or bearer.
Why is layered modular architecture important?
A product is created by orchestrating components from heterogeneous layers, while components can be used in ways their designers cannot fully anticipate.
What are loose couplings?
Connections between layers
that allow innovation to emerge independently at different layers.
What can loose couplings lead to?
Innovation can emerge independently at different layers,
leading to cascading effects on other layers
What is generativity?
A technology’s overall capacity
to produce unprompted change
driven by large, varied, and uncoordinated audiences.
What is ontological reversal?
The digital version is created first, and the physical version is created second, if needed.
What is the direction of ontological reversal?
Digital → Physical
Instead of:
Physical → Digital
